District Population Welfare Officer Jacobabad Jobs 2026 for Drivers, Naib Qasid, Chowkidar & Aya / Helper
The Office of the District Population Welfare Officer (DPWO), Jacobabad, Population Welfare Department, Government of Sindh, invites applications from eligible local candidates for appointment against Class-IV vacancies (BPS-01 to BPS-04). Positions are offered under the Sindh Civil Servants (Appointment, Promotion, and Transfer) Rules, 1974.
Eligible candidates possessing a valid domicile and Permanent Residence Certificate (PRC Form-D) of District Jacobabad can apply for support staff positions, including Driver, Naib Qasid, Chowkidar, and Aya/Helper. Educated applicants will be given preference for non-technical positions.
List of Vacancies
-
Driver (BPS-04)
-
Naib Qasid (BPS-02)
-
Chowkidar (BPS-02)
-
Aya / Helper (BPS-02)
Terms & Conditions
-
Domicile Eligibility: Applicants must hold a domicile and Permanent Residence Certificate (PRC Form-D) of District Jacobabad. Postings will be local across District Jacobabad.
-
Age Limit & Relaxation: Candidates must be between 18 and 28 years of age. Upper age relaxation will be granted in accordance with Government of Sindh recruitment rules and policy.
-
Driver Requirements: Applicants for the post of Driver must possess a valid LTV Driving License along with two (02) years of relevant driving experience and a minimum qualification of Matriculation.
-
Preference for Other Posts: For Naib Qasid, Chowkidar, and Aya/Helper posts, preference will be given to candidates with educational qualifications.
-
Reserved Quotas: Applicable government quotas for women, minorities, and differently-abled (disabled) individuals will be strictly observed as per Sindh Government policy.
-
Government Employees: Applicants currently employed in government, semi-government, autonomous, or local bodies must submit their applications through proper channels along with a No Objection Certificate (NOC).
-
Separate Applications: Candidates applying for more than one position must submit separate application forms along with complete sets of required documents.
-
Shortlisting & TA/DA: Only eligible and shortlisted candidates will be called for tests/interviews. No TA/DA will be paid for attending any stage of the recruitment process.
-
Authority Rights: The competent authority reserves the right to increase, decrease, or cancel the number of posts without assigning any reason.
How to Apply
-
Write or print a job application on plain paper clearly specifying the name of the post applied for.
-
Attach attested photocopies of the following credentials:
-
Computerized National Identity Card (CNIC)
-
Domicile Certificate & PRC Form-D (District Jacobabad)
-
Educational certificates/degrees and transcripts
-
Experience certificates (and valid LTV Driving License for Driver post)
-
Disability Certificate issued by a competent authority (for disabled quota applicants)
-
No Objection Certificate / NOC (for existing government servants)
-
Two (02) recent passport-size photographs
-
Deliver the completed application package to the Office of the District Population Welfare Officer, Jacobabad.
Last Date to Apply
Applications must reach the Office of the District Population Welfare Officer, Jacobabad, within 15 days from the date of publication of the advertisement.
Incomplete applications or those received past the deadline will not be processed.
